Manasseh Bailey (born June 27, 1997) is an American football wide receiver who is currently a free agent. He played college football at Morgan State. He has been a member of the Philadelphia Eagles, Los Angeles Chargers, and New York Jets of the National Football League (NFL); Montreal Alouettes of the Canadian Football League (CFL); the DC Defenders of the XFL and Birmingham Stallions of the United States Football League (USFL).

Profesional career edit

Philadelphia Eagles edit

Bailey signed with the Philadelphia Eagles as an undrafted free agent following the 2020 NFL Draft on April 26, 2020.[1] He was waived during final roster cuts on September 3, 2020,[2]

Los Angeles Chargers edit

On December 9, 2020, Bailey was signed to the Los Angeles Chargers' practice squad.[3] On December 12, 2020, Bailey was released from the Los Angeles Chargers.[4]

New York Jets edit

On January 13, 2021, Bailey signed a future contract with the New York Jets.[5]

Montreal Alouettes edit

On October 9, 2021, Bailey signed with the Montreal Alouettes and was put on the Practice Squad on October 26, 2021.[6]

Birmingham Stallions edit

Bailey was selected in the 17th round of the 2022 USFL draft by the Birmingham Stallions.[7] He was released on April 22, 2022.[8]

DC Defenders edit

Bailey was selected by the DC Defenders in the 2023 XFL Draft.[9]

Winnipeg Blue Bombers edit

On March 13, 2023, Bailey signed with the Winnipeg Blue Bombers of the Canadian Football League (CFL).[10] On June 3, 2023, Bailey was released by the Blue Bombers.[11]
